Product Philosophy
User-Centered Design
I believe in deeply understanding user needs and pain points to create products that truly solve problems and delight users.
Data-Driven Decisions
I rely on data and research to validate assumptions and make informed product decisions rather than following hunches.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
Success comes from effective collaboration across design, engineering, and business teams to create cohesive product experiences.
